  • This study investigated how Schwartz' value system(1992) would interfere with SNS users' motivations and behavioral responses. The study result shows that values are characterized in terms of openness, mutual reciprocity, self enhancement, normative compliance, and security. Each of them exerted differential impact on SNS usage motives, social capital, ad response, and word-of-mouth, among others. The five values were used as an input for segmenting SNS users and clustering method produced four value segments; experience seeker, interdependent sympathizer, self enhancer, and norm-bound. Each value group not only influenced SNS perceptions and behavioral responses differently, but also showed a systematic relationship with SNS service types. The study findings demonstrate that Schwartz's value system provides a very useful theoretical basis for understanding the psychological mechanism underlying SNS usage.

  • In industrial wireless sensor networks, many applications require integrated QoS supporting. This paper proposes a reliable protocol for real-time monitoring in industrial wireless sensor networks. Retransmission is well-known to recover the transmission failure, however, this might cause the time delay to violate the real-time requirement. The proposed protocol exploits broadcasting feature of wireless networks and the temporal opportunity concept. The opportunities to relay the data packets are shared by the broadcasting feature and the temporal opportunity concept maximize the number of candidates in communication. Simulation results show that the proposed protocol is superior to the existing real-time protocols in term of real-time service and reliability.

  • Recently, Electronic Data Interchange (EDI) systems are widely used. Many organizations exchange the documents by using EDI, and EDI is used in various industries such as physical distribution, export and import business, custom, and medical care. However, there have been little attempt to empirically investigate the success factors of EDI system. In this paper, we identify the influencing factors which determine the success of typical information system and then suggest the additional factors characterized to the EDI system. Our research model, mainly based on the system success model, is tested by analyzing the empirical data acquired from the companies in the medical industry. As a result, the system quality, information quality, service quality, and the perceived sacrifice turned out to be significant to the success of EDI system while data security does not. The result of this research is likely to help providing useful guidelines for the successful EDI implementations.

  • Recently, many studies on VNDN technology have been conducted to graft Named Data Networking (NDN) into VANET as a core network technology. VNDN can use the content name to deliver various infotainment application content data through name-based forwarding. When VNDN is used as a communication technology for infotainment applications in connected vehicles, it is possible to realize data-centric networking technology in which data is the subject of communication. It can overcome the limitations of connected vehicle infotainment application service technology based on the host-centric current Internet, such as security attack/hacking, performance degradation in long-distance data transmission, frequent data cut-off. In this paper, we present the main functions provided by VNDN technology, and systematically analyze and organize the issues necessary to realize infotainment application services for connected vehicles in the VNDN environment. Based on this, it can be utilized as basic information necessary to establish infotainment application requirements in VNDN environment.

  • Machine learning techniques using visual data have high usability in fields of industry and service such as scene recognition, fault detection, security and user analysis. Among these, user analysis through the videos from CCTV is one of the practical way of using vision data. Also, many studies about lightweight artificial neural network have been published to increase high usability for mobile and embedded environment so far. In this study, we propose the network combining the object detection and classification for mobile graphic processing unit. This network detects pedestrian and face, classifies age and gender from detected face. Proposed network is constructed based on MobileNet, YOLOv2 and skip connection. Both detection and classification models are trained individually and combined as 2-stage structure. Also, attention mechanism is used to improve detection and classification ability. Nvidia Jetson Nano is used to run and evaluate the proposed system.

  • In recent years the popularity of multi-hop wireless networks has been growing. Its flexible topology and abundant routing path enables many types of applications. However, the lack of a centralized controller often makes it difficult to design a reliable service in multi-hop wireless networks. While packet routing has been the center of attention for decades, recent research focuses on data discovery such as file sharing in multi-hop wireless networks. Although there are many peer-to-peer lookup (P2P-lookup) schemes for wired networks, they have inherent limitations for multi-hop wireless networks. First, a wired P2P-lookup builds a search structure on the overlay network and disregards the underlying topology. Second, the performance guarantee often relies on specific topology models such as random graphs, which do not apply to multi-hop wireless networks. Past studies on wireless P2P-lookup either combined existing solutions with known routing algorithms or proposed tree-based routing, which is prone to traffic congestion. In this paper, we present two wireless P2P-lookup schemes that strictly build a topology-dependent structure. We first propose the Ring Interval Graph Search (RIGS) that constructs a DHT only through direct connections between the nodes. We then propose the ValleyWalk, a loosely-structured scheme that requires simple local hints for query routing. Packet-level simulations showed that RIGS can find the target with near-shortest search length and ValleyWalk can find the target with near-shortest search length when there is at least 5% object replication. We also provide an analytic bound on the search length of ValleyWalk.

  • As technology has developed and cost for data processing has reduced, big data market has grown bigger. Developed countries such as the United States have constantly invested in big data industry and achieved some remarkable results like improving advertisement effects and getting patents for customer service. Every company aims to achieve long-term survival and profit maximization, but it needs to establish a good strategy, considering current industrial conditions so that it can accomplish its goal in big data industry. However, since domestic big data industry is at its initial stage, local companies lack systematic method to establish competitive strategy. Therefore, this research aims to help local companies diagnose their big data capabilities through a reference model and big data capability assessment system. Big data reference model consists of five maturity levels such as Ad hoc, Repeatable, Defined, Managed and Optimizing and five key dimensions such as Organization, Resources, Infrastructure, People, and Analytics. Big data assessment system is planned based on the reference model's key factors. In the Organization area, there are 4 key diagnosis factors, big data leadership, big data strategy, analytical culture and data governance. In Resource area, there are 3 factors, data management, data integrity and data security/privacy. In Infrastructure area, there are 2 factors, big data platform and data management technology. In People area, there are 3 factors, training, big data skills and business-IT alignment. In Analytics area, there are 2 factors, data analysis and data visualization. These reference model and assessment system would be a useful guideline for local companies.

  • In hosting outdoor activities and school trips, safety issues are gaining serious attention lately. In addition to Sewol ferry tragedy and an incident at Kyungjoo Mauna Resort, there have been grown problems related to this crucial factor. This research analyzes negligent accidents occurred from domestic and foreign schools and aims to provide effective safety education and policy through comparative analysis between domestic and foreign cases. We mainly relied on documents such as newspapers, internet articles and legal papers to investigate cases and cooperated with relevant government departments for collecting references and setting agenda for safety supervision. The analysis on both domestic and foreign cases revealed that students abroad receive opportunities for first-hand experience regarding safety and systematic education, as safety maintenance is prioritized. Based on this culture, safety education should be habituated domestically, while participatory safety programs that students can actively involve must also be devised. Moreover, through preparation of entertaining contents such as SNS game programs, skits and activities employing multiple facilities and vehicles at school safety education, we must induce students to actively participate in the program with interests.

  • Although various IT-based services including PMIS are used at construction field, there have been limits on communications, such as fast reaction, information loss, and information security in the real world. Therefore, this paper proposes to adapt a social network service (SNS) that has already been used for information management and sharing information at the company level in other industries in order to support construction information management and communication in a fast and accurate manner. Following the requirement analysis through literature review and site interviews, the paper presents an SNS-based construction information communication and sharing system named PMIS+. PMIS+ was tested and validated for its feasibility at construction sites and it was proved that the proposed system and information management framework using the system could be helpful for effective information management at construction fields.

  • This thesis examines the performance and improvement strategy of SWIFTNet TSU's BPO for computerization and suggests the following results: First, the URBPO should be legally complemented, and the SWIFT and banks need to keep improving the systems to meet trade parties' diverse needs. Second, the SWIFTNet TSU's BPO should have an institutionally unified sharing platform with security, stability and convenience. In other words, it is needed to develop services which meet e-payment paradigm and international and regional environments through continued analysis on market changes and flow. Third, in order for the SWIFTNet TSU BPO to evolve into a perfect global system, there should be an innovative payment solution which can meet all trade parties all over the world. For this, technology standardization for a worldwide e-trade payment system is essential. Lastly, based on the results derived from this study, an analysis framework with which more diverse and practical environmental variables can be analyzed should be developed.
